cypress-parallel-cli is the tool that will be used by cypress-parallel to run cypress unit testing in parallel.
At the execution of each spec, it will send back the result to the API.
To debug your code directly in the docker container, do this:
sudo docker run --rm --entrypoint="" -v $PWD:/tmp/cypress-parallel-cli -exec -ti ghcr.io/lord-y/cypress-parallel-docker-images/cypress-parallel-docker-images:10.10.0-2.0 bash
# install golang
cd /tmp/cypress-parallel-cli
scripts/golang.sh 1.19.2
source ~/.bashrc
# exemple of command
export CYPRESS_PARALLEL_CLI_LOG_LEVEL=debug
export CYPRESS_PARALLEL_CLI_LOG_LEVEL_WITH_CALLER=true
go run main.go cypress --repository https://github.com/cypress-io/cypress-example-kitchensink.git --branch master --specs cypress/e2e/2-advanced-examples/connectors.cy.js --uid uuid --report-backAdd githook like so:

go tool cover -html=coverage.outTo know which cypress, chrome and firefox version to use for version 9.7.0, do:
sudo docker run --rm --entrypoint="" -exec -ti cypress/included:9.7.0 bash
cypress --version
firefox --version
google-chrome --version
